Dwane Kint has dedicated more than four decades of his life to the Marianna Volunteer Fire Company and now members of the fire company and community want to aid him in his fight against cancer.
A spaghetti dinner fundraiser is planned for noon to 6 p.m. Jan. 29 at the fire company无毛视频檚 social hall at 84 Broad St.

Kint, 62, is a lifelong resident of Marianna and served on that community无毛视频檚 borough council for 16 years and has either been the fire chief or president of the fire department for the last 44 years.

Kint was diagnosed with cancer in September and has undergone three surgeries since. He also recently began chemotherapy.

Proceeds of the fundraiser will help offset the cost of Kint无毛视频檚 medical bills, as well as compensate for lost wages and help cover the cost of everyday living.
The price is $10 for adults and $5 for those younger than 10 for the all-you-can-eat spaghetti dinner. Eat-in and take-out will be available. There also will be a Chinese auction, raffles and other games to help raise funds.
Dinner will include meatballs, bread and butter, salad and beverages. Tickets will be available at the door but also may be purchased in advance at The Novelty Shoppe, 1750 Main St., near the Marianna Post Office.
